Translation by Dr. Muhammad Muhsin Khan & Dr. Taqi-ud-Din al-Hilali
And that which she used to worship besides Allâh has prevented her (from Islâm), for she was of a disbelieving people.

Tafsir Ahsan al-Bayan — Hafiz Salahuddin Yusuf
Tafsir Ahsan al-Bayan is a well-known Quran commentary by Hafiz Salahuddin Yusuf, a renowned Salafi (Ahl al-Hadith) scholar from Pakistan. This tafsir explains the meanings of the Quran in accordance with the methodology of the Salaf (early righteous generations), relying on authentic sources and straightforward language. Due to its reliability and adherence to sound Islamic scholarship, the Saudi government publishes and distributes this tafsir among the Hujjaj (pilgrims) visiting the Haramain. The tafsir is originally written in Urdu, translated to English by tohed.com.

That is, what had prevented her from worshipping Allah was the worship of others besides Allah, and the reason for this was that she belonged to a disbelieving people, therefore she remained unaware of the reality of Tawheed, that is, Allah or by Allah’s command, Sulaiman (AS) stopped her from worshipping others besides Allah; but the first opinion is more Sahih (Fath al-Qadeer).
